Musiknotation mit ABC
Es gibt grafische Notensatzprogramme und umfassende Musiksoftware, die bei Bedarf Noten produziert. Das eine oder andere dieser Programme ist vielleicht auch kostenlos verfügbar, aber nicht für jedes Betriebssystem. Und dann stellt sich die Frage, was passiert, wenn man die Software wechselt. Können die alten Noten weiter verarbeitet werden?
Es gibt zwei halbwegs verbreitete freie Textformate zum Erfassen und Setzen von Musik:
- Lilypond und
- ABC
Lilypond erhebt den Anspruch, den besten Musiknotensatz zu produzieren. Mit Lilypond ist grundsätzlich alles möglich, es hat jedoch eine steile Lernkurve. Für längere Werke in mehrstimmigem Satz ist es sicherlich erste Wahl.
ABC kommt dagegen komplett schlicht daher:
X:1 T:House of the Rising Sun
R:3/4
L:1/4
K:Am
A | A2 B|c2 e | d2 A | c2 a | a2 a | g3/2 (e1/2 d) | e3- | e2 a |
Das ist die erste Hälfte von House of the Rising Sun (nur Melodie). Mit Griffen und Text wird es etwas komplizierter. Hier das ganze Stück:
X:1
T:House of the Rising Sun
C:traditional
R:3/4
L:1/4
K:Am
A | "Am" A2 B| "C" c2 e | "D" d2 A | "F" c2 a | "Am" a2 a | "C" g3/2 (e1/2 d) | "E" e3- | "E7" e2 a |
w:There is a house in New Or- leans, they call the ri- sing _ sun. _ It's
"Am" a2 a | "C" g g e | "D" d/d/ d A | "F" c2 A | "Am" A2 A | "E7" (G#/2 E3/2) G | "Am" A3- | "E7" A2 |]
w:been the ru- in of ma- ny a poor girl and me, oh Lord, _ is one. _
Der Punkt ist: Das können Sie so per E-Mail verschicken, das können Sie mit Copy und Paste in einem ABC-Konverter Ihrer Wahl darstellen und ausdrucken. In Ihre Website können Sie abcjs einbetten und damit ordentliche Noten anzeigen. Und, falls Sie keine Software greifbar haben: Bei Tonarten ohne Vorzeichen (A moll, C Dur, D dorisch …) können Sie die Notenwerte ablesen und spielen. Unter dem mittleren C werden Großbuchstaben verwendet, ab dort klein.
ABC-Notation entspricht hier der Devise, die Larry Wall als Grundlage für die Entwicklung der Programmiersprache Perl genommen hat: “make easy things easy, and hard things possible?”
Das vielleicht beste an ABC ist, dass zehntausende von Folkstücken (vorwiegend aus dem englischsprachigen Raum) im Internet frei in ABC-Notation verfügbar sind.
Natürlich gibt es auch Nachteile:
- ABC-Notation hat sich über Jahre entwickelt. Bei Code aus dem 20. Jahrhundert müssen Sie eventuell Anpassungen vornehmen.
- ABC-Notation ist nicht vollständig. Direktiven sind nicht einheitlich geregelt.
- Mehrstimmiger Satz ist möglich, aber kompliziert.
Ausgewählte Links
- Melodiensammlungen
- John Chambers – veraltete Benutzeroberfläche, unübersichtlich, aber die vermutlich umfangreichste Sammlung.
- Jack Campin – speziell ältere englische Stücke.
- Tunes bei forum.melodeon.net. Besonders erwähnenswert das “Lester's massive tunebook”.
- Henry Norbecks Seite – modernisierte Oberfläche, mit über Jahre gesammelten Tunes.
- The Session – umfangreiche Sammlung irischer Musik. Leider gibt es manche Tunes in Dutzenden, nur leicht voneinander abweichenden Versionen.
- ABC-Standard Version 2.2 – falls Sie es genau wissen müssen.
- JavaScript-Bibliothek abcjs – um ABC in Ihre Website zu bringen.
- ABC Spieler und Editor – mit Transposition, von Clive Williams
Es gibt etliche ABC-Tutorials im Netz, ich habe auf keines verlinkt, in der Annahme, dass Sie zunächst vorwiegend vorhandene Stücke darstellen und drucken.